Potluck and Mac swap at Broken Arrow Park in Lawrence

Every year, the Macintosh User Group in Lawrence gets together for a swap meet + picnic in the park. This year's event is at Broken Arrow Park, 29th and Louisiana, at 7 p.m. on Wednesday. The point, of course, is to bond over the superiority of Apple computers while swigging sweet tea and nomming on potato salad. Plus, Apple users can try unloading some of their old equipment onto other people. "People bring their old software, maybe some add-ons such as zip drives. It's frequently a nostalgia trip becuase someone will bring an old program and half the people will be like 'What is that for' and the other half tells stories about how they first used that program. Last year, someone had a few dial up modems and we talked about those days when people were using AOL on a 14.4 modem," says group member David Greenbaum.

So, you're ready to trade out your first-generation iPod. How do you decide what food to bring? Greenbaum offered the following breakdown for guidance:

Leopard Users: Main dish

Tiger users: Side dish

Panther: Dessert

Running more than one: Your choice

Not running one of these: Save your money and bring a drink (and then

upgrade)
